About A. Glickman
A. Glickman is a scholar working on Agronomy and Crop Science, Microbiology, Pharmacology, Small Animals and Infectious Diseases, having authored 31 papers that have together received 826 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Milk Quality and Mastitis in Dairy Cows (14 papers), Microbial infections and disease research (13 papers), Antibiotics Pharmacokinetics and Efficacy (12 papers), Probiotics and Fermented Foods (4 papers),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(3 papers), Veterinary medicine and infectious diseases (3 papers), Streptococcal Infections and Treatments (2 papers) and Coccidia and coccidiosis research (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Agronomy and Crop Science (510 citations), Microbiology (242 citations), Food Science (320 citations), Molecular Medicine (79 citations) and Small Animals (88 citations). A. Glickman has collaborated with scholars based in Israel and Poland. Frequent co-authors include A. Saran, M. Winkler, Gabriel Leitner, M. Chaffer, Ziv Gan‐Or, E. Ezra, Oleg Krifucks, Z. Trainin, G. Ziv and Eran Lavy.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Veterinary Pharmacology and Therapeutics, Small Ruminant Research, Research in Veterinary Science, Veterinary Immunology and Immunopathology and American Journal of Veterinary Research.
